commit 26061e4e542d220c577fb3437a9a9f108dc27698
Author: Konstantin Belousov <kib@FreeBSD.org>
AuthorDate: 2025-07-06 12:18:11 +0000
Commit: Konstantin Belousov <kib@FreeBSD.org>
CommitDate: 2025-07-06 21:14:14 +0000
kern: add kern_nosys() and use it instead of type-punning the sys_nosys() arg
Sponsored by: The FreeBSD Foundation
MFC after: 1 week
---
sys/kern/kern_sig.c | 9 +++++++--
sys/kern/kern_syscalls.c | 5 +++--
sys/kern/sysv_msg.c | 2 +-
sys/kern/sysv_sem.c | 2 +-
sys/kern/sysv_shm.c | 2 +-
sys/sys/syscallsubr.h | 1 +
6 files changed, 14 insertions(+), 7 deletions(-)
diff --git a/sys/kern/kern_sig.c b/sys/kern/kern_sig.c
index a61ebfc5c7c8..5d51aa675cb7 100644
--- a/sys/kern/kern_sig.c
+++ b/sys/kern/kern_sig.c
@@ -1050,8 +1050,7 @@ osigaction(struct thread *td, struct osigaction_args *uap)
int
osigreturn(struct thread *td, struct osigreturn_args *uap)
{
-
- return (nosys(td, (struct nosys_args *)uap));
+ return (kern_nosys(td, 0));
}
#endif
#endif /* COMPAT_43 */
@@ -4287,6 +4286,12 @@ struct nosys_args {
/* ARGSUSED */
int
nosys(struct thread *td, struct nosys_args *args)
+{
+ return (kern_nosys(td, args->dummy));
+}
+
+int
+kern_nosys(struct thread *td, int dummy)
{
struct proc *p;
